Software Overview and Benefits
TextFree is more than just another messaging application. At its core, it provides users with a free phone number that can be used to send texts and make calls without costing a dime. One of the app's key features lies in its ability to enable users to communicate without revealing their personal phone numbers, maintaining privacy while fostering connections. This is especially advantageous for individuals and professionals who wish to keep their personal lives separate from their business dealings.

Pricing and Plans
TextFree adopts a freemium model, where basic services can be accessed for free. Users can send texts and make calls without any charges, but there are limitations in terms of features and advertisements. To enhance functionality, premium options are available, which can be unlocked through in-app purchases.
Compared to rivals like Google Voice and TextNow, TextFreeâs pricing tactics are upfront, making it accessible for those wary of hidden fees or complicated subscription models. What is TextFree?
TextFree is an internet-based communication app that allows users to send text messages and make voice calls without incurring hefty charges. By using Wi-Fi or cellular data, it allows people to stay in touch regardless of location. The convenience of having a dedicated phone number thatâs not tied to a credit card or a traditional phone service provider has made it increasingly popular.

How TextFree Stacks Against WhatsApp
When comparing TextFree to WhatsApp, several key differences emerge. Both platforms cater to a broad audience, but with distinct approaches. WhatsApp is renowned for its end-to-end encryption and security policies, attracting users who prioritize privacy. TextFree, on the other hand, primarily leans into providing free services without requiring users to pay for messaging or calling.
- Cost of Service: TextFree is completely free for messaging and calling within the US and Canada, whereas WhatsApp relies on data bundles to function. Users should weigh their communication needs against the costs each app might incur.
- Features: WhatsApp supports multimedia sharing, voice and video calls, and group chats. In comparison, while TextFree offers text messaging and calling features, multimedia functionality is limited, which might leave some users yearning for more.
- Interface: WhatsAppâs interface is polished and familiar to many users, with easy navigation. TextFreeâs user interface, while simple, may seem outdated, making some features less accessible than those of WhatsApp.
In a nutshell, those who need a secure and feature-rich app may find WhatsApp a better fit. However, if the primary need is simply to send messages without worrying about costs, TextFree becomes a strong contender.
TextFree vs. Google Voice
Google Voice serves a different purpose than TextFree; it's designed more for business and enterprise users seeking comprehensive communication tools. However, both share common features that can aid casual users as well.
- Business vs. Personal Use: Google Voice caters to business communications, providing features like voicemail transcripts and call forwarding. TextFree focuses on personal use, providing a free, easy-to-use messaging service which may attract less demanding users.
- Integration and Features: Google Voice integrates smoothly with other Google services, making it ideal for users deeply embedded in Google's ecosystem. The app provides a rich array of tools for voicemail management and call screening, which potential users may find appealing. In contrast, TextFree has limited integrations but shines in simplicity and accessibility.
- Call Quality: Call quality tends to favor Google Voice due to its infrastructure and reliability of services. TextFree can still provide decent quality, but it sometimes faces fluctuations based on internet connectivity and other factors.
